The presentation focuses not only on the legal standards applicable to the valuation (full or adequate compensation, reparations, restitution, actual loss, fair market value, fair or reasonably equivalent value, lost profits, etc.), but also on the informed judgment and reasonableness that must enter into the process of weighing the facts of each case and determining its aggregate significance.
In its practical assistance to arbitral tribunals presented with complex business valuation in the quantum phase of a hearing, this book shows a thoughtful andproactive arbitrator how to help him or herself and provides a full measure of the valuation expertise required. In a more deeply significant way, the author reveals how the arbitration community can move closer toward a common language and consistent principles -- a Valuation Mercatoria.
